What is the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form?
The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form is designed for individuals who wish to file a small claims action but cannot afford the associated filing fees. The form serves to assist those facing financial constraints by allowing them to submit a request for a waiver of these fees. This form aims to make the court system more accessible for individuals who lack the financial means to initiate legal action.

Who Needs the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form?
This form is particularly beneficial for individuals from low-income backgrounds, those experiencing sudden financial hardships, or anyone facing extraordinary expenses that inhibit their ability to pay court fees. For example, a single parent might need to file a claim for unpaid child support but might not have the funds to cover court costs.
Eligibility Criteria for the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form
To qualify for a fee waiver, petitioners must meet specific eligibility requirements. These typically include income limits that align with the federal poverty guidelines, asset requirements that assess financial standing, and other factors that demonstrate the necessity for assistance.

Submission Methods for the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form
The completed form can be submitted to the court through various methods. Options include physical submission at the court clerk's office, online submission via appropriate court portals, or mailing the document directly to the court. Ensure to choose the method that best suits your circumstances.
What Happens After You Submit the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form?
After submission, you can check the status of your fee waiver application through the court’s system. The processing time may vary, but you can generally expect notification from the court regarding whether your fees have been waived or if additional information is needed.

Who is eligible to submit the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form?
Individuals in Indiana who are filing a small claims action and are unable to afford the filing fees are eligible to submit this form. You must demonstrate financial need through details of your income and expenses.
What supporting documents might I need when submitting this form?
When submitting the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form, you may need to provide supporting documents such as proof of income, bank statements, and a detailed listing of your monthly expenses to validate your financial need.
How do I submit the completed fee waiver form?
Once you have completed the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form, you can submit it by mailing it to the appropriate court in Indiana or, if available, using an online submission process approved by the court.
Are there any common mistakes I should av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es to avoid include leaving fields blank, failing to sign the form, and not providing accurate financial information. Review your form thoroughly to ensure every detail is completed correctly.
How long does it take to process the fee waiver once submitted?
The processing time for the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form can vary by court. Typically, it may take several weeks. It's advisable to check with the specific court for more accurate timing.
Is there a fee for filing the fee waiver form?
There is no fee to file the Indiana Small Claims Court Fee Waiver Form itself. However, you may still need to pay applicable fees once your fees are waived or if your case proceeds.
